Abstract
Silica interacts with TMP by two kinds of acid sites: with weak acid support sites through the isolated silanol groups and with strong Brönsted acid, which lead to the formation of TMPH+, through the hydrogen-bonded silanol groups. Silica only interacts with HPW through its isolated silanol groups.
